From f9b9fdb195f67298ae1ba2236dd4986360d8ade2 Mon Sep 17 00:00:00 2001 From: lspgn Date: Sat, 6 Jan 2024 00:58:36 -0800 Subject: [PATCH] goflow2: zero queue_size means blocking --- cmd/goflow2/main.go |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/cmd/goflow2/main.go b/cmd/goflow2/main.go index 1e68f69..9697c0a 100644 --- a/cmd/goflow2/main.go +++ b/cmd/goflow2/main.go @@ -226,6 +226,10 @@ func main() { queueSize = 1000000 } + if queueSize == 0 { + isBlocking = true + } + hostname := listenAddrUrl.Hostname() port, err := strconv.ParseUint(listenAddrUrl.Port(), 10, 64) if err != nil {